
Men's National Team
Comprising top male tennis players in Jordan, this team represents the nation in various international tournaments and Davis Cup competitions.

Women's National Team
Consisting of highly skilled female tennis players, the Women's National Team competes in international events and Fed Cup competitions, showcasing Jordan's talent on the global stage.

Junior National Team
This team comprises promising young talent in Jordan's tennis community. It nurtures junior players, preparing them for future national and international competitions.

Junior Tennis Initiative
The national JTI provides opportunities for children to pick up a racket for the first time, encouraging them to play in locally organized competitions and sessions within schools, the community and tennis venues to enjoy the sport.
Launch Point
It is the launch point for many aspiring competitive players and a platform to introduce more talent to the game within our country’s national development program.
Opportunity
It provides opportunities for aspiring tennis coaches, to become involved too, and these deliverers are key for driving increased participation in the sport.
3 programs
The Initiative is split into 3 programs annually, with each program running for 12 weeks and includes 12-one hour training session for each child. At the end of each program a Festival Fun Day is held to celebrate the young athletes
Jordan Development Training Program

Training
The Jordan Tennis Federation Development Program is an exclusive initiative dedicated to nurturing promising young tennis talent, providing comprehensive training in both technical skills and physical conditioning

Mentality
Led by experienced coaches, the program offers rigorous sessions aimed at honing fundamental techniques and enhancing overall athleticism. Additionally, it emphasizes mental toughness, sportsmanship, and a balanced lifestyle to foster holistic growth.

Foundation
By instilling a strong foundation of skills, fitness, and personal integrity, the program aims to empower young athletes to excel on national and international stages, shaping them into impactful contributors to the world of tennis
